Chaos-based Image/Signal Encryption
TopicLeading institutions, researchers & key papers
This cluster of papers focuses on chaos-based techniques for encrypting digital images, utilizing chaotic maps, optical encryption, DNA sequences, and compressive sensing. It explores various aspects such as cryptanalysis, random number generation, and security analysis in the context of image encryption.
